    "Back in the 1980s and 1990s, one of the most popular and successful investment gurus and newsletter editors was Martin Zweig, editor of the Zweig Forecast, author of Winning on Wall Street and chairman of Zweig Funds. Zweig is now out of the newsletter business and has sold his fund company. In fact, he may be best known today for owning the most expensive apartment in Manhattan, a $70 million triplex penthouse on top of the Pierre Hotel on Central Park at Fifth Avenue. "
